The Sheriff in “Stranger Things”

David Harbour’s career took a significant turn with his portrayal of Jim Hopper, the no-nonsense police chief of Hawkins, Indiana. In a series that artfully combines supernatural elements with deep emotional storytelling, Hopper emerges as a character with a rich backstory, grounding his heroism in realism. Here are some key highlights of Harbour’s role as Hopper:

– **Character Depth**: Harbour’s portrayal illustrates the struggles of a man burdened by past traumas, loss, and personal demons while safeguarding the innocent.
– **Emotional Range**: His performance captures Hopper’s tough exterior and hidden vulnerabilities, resonating deeply with audiences.
– **Modern Masculinity**: Hopper symbolizes a departure from conventional male characters, depicting the complexities of contemporary manhood, including struggles with addiction and fatherhood.

Transition to Superhero: “Hellboy”

In 2019, David Harbour took a bold step into the world of superheroes by assuming the title role in the reboot of “Hellboy.” This character, steeped in rich comic book lore, provided Harbour with an opportunity to break the mold of traditional superhero portrayals. Key aspects of Harbour’s portrayal include:

– **Flawed Heroism**: Harbour delivered a performance that showcases Hellboy’s internal conflicts, emphasizing that superhuman abilities do not exempt one from personal demons.
– **Dramatic and Dark Comedy Blend**: His portrayal also brings a unique mix of action and humor, charting new territory in superhero narratives that often focus solely on action.
– **Relatability**: By emphasizing Hellboy’s struggles between two worlds—humanity and the supernatural—Harbour provides a reflection on identity and acceptance, making the character relatable to audiences beyond the superhero genre.
